
Group fitness can be a great way for people to meet and get in shape. USF Recreation & Wellness offers a free range of group fitness classes. Participants can choose from a wide variety of classes, from Total Body Strength to Yoga. They are all nationally certified and will give a challenging yet rewarding workout to all levels of fitness. No matter if you are a beginner or an experienced pro, there is a class that will suit you.

While the gym is free to the public, group fitness classes will be offered via Microsoft Teams. You will find the schedule and any other information here. All Group Fitness classes are free to attend, so there's no need to make a reservation ahead of time. You can register for a class online or at a kiosk in the Campus Recreation Center lobby. Register as "Standbys" for classes that have more than one sign-up. This is available up to five minutes before the class starts. Group Fitness has another unique feature: Group Cycle. This class is an indoor cycling class that challenges riders to increase their speed and endurance. What kind of food should I avoid when trying to lose weight?
Avoid trans fats. Trans fats can increase LDL (the negative) cholesterol levels and decrease HDL (the positive) cholesterol.
Trans fats are commonly found in fast food, deep-fried and packaged baked goods as well snack cakes and other processed foods.
These unhealthy fats also cause inflammation, leading to heart disease and diabetes.
